Here's what Basin has to say about Dr. Spot...
Dr. Spot is our own special soap to get rid of those tough spots on clothes and other laundry. We have had great success getting out blood, chocolate, oil, grease, spaghetti sauce, baby formula and other hard to get rid of stains.

Wet area to be cleaned, rub Dr. Spot directly on stain, rub and wash as usual.

WARNING: Try on hidden area first to test colorfastness. It can cause certain fabrics/dyes to discolor.
